Dehradun, Aug. 17 -- Uttarakhand Chief Minister Pushkar Singh Dhami distributed appointment letters to approximately 220 medical officers. Under CM Dhami's leadership, a record 24,000 youths have secured government jobs in the last four years, according to the state government.

Addressing the event, Uttarakhand CM Pushkar Singh Dhami said the appointment of 220 medical officers will improve immediate medical services and staff efficiency; the government is focused on expanding health services and strengthening public health infrastructure.
